Job DescriptionWe’re looking for a senior manager, global equity & reward, to help deliver innovative equity compensation solutions for multinational clients. In this role, you’ll manage projects across the full life cycle of global share plans—supporting design, implementation, and compliance—while collaborating with senior stakeholders in HR, Finance, Payroll, and Tax. You’ll work as part of a truly global team operating under a hub model, with core professionals in the US, UK, and Australia, and access to in‑country specialists in 70+ jurisdictions.
Our structure eliminates silos, enabling seamless cross‑border collaboration and knowledge sharing. This is an opportunity to combine technical understanding with strategic thinking—helping clients align equity programs with business goals while ensuring compliance and operational excellence.

- Cross‑Functional Coordination:
Partner with HR, Payroll, Finance, and Tax teams to implement processes for equity administration, reporting, and compliance across jurisdictions. - Client Delivery & Relationship Management:
Act as a key point of contact for client projects—managing timelines, deliverables, and quality standards while building trusted relationships. - Compliance & Risk Oversight:
Help establish governance frameworks, maintain documentation, and coordinate year‑end reporting for equity programs globally. - Equity Program Management:
Support the design and roll‑out of global equity plans, ensuring alignment with market practices, compliance requirements, and client objectives. - Team Development:
Mentor junior team members, review work for accuracy, and contribute to a collaborative, inclusive team culture. - Insights & Analytics:
Support development of dashboards and reporting tools to track participation, compliance, and market trends.
- 10+ years in equity compensation, global reward, or related field.
- Experience managing multi‑country share‑plan rollouts and compliance processes.
- Strong project management and stakeholder engagement skills.
- Familiarity with equity administration platforms and integrations.
- Professional credential preferred (CEP, CPA/CA, or equivalent).
- Understanding of global tax and payroll implications for equity awards.
- Awareness of accounting standards (IFRS 2/ASC 718) and governance best practices.
- Proficiency in Excel and data visualization tools.
